Jones: Ricciardo grows horns when it counts

– 1980 Formula 1 World Champion Alan Jones believes fellow Australian Daniel Ricciardo is now "a contender" and has proved he is capable of running with the best of them following his victory in the Hungarian Grand Prix.Ricciardo took his second win of the season at the Hungaroring on Sunday with two fine late passes on F1 World Champions Lewis Hamilton and Fernando Alonso.The triumph came less than eight weeks after he had taken his maiden F1 victory in Canada on June 8."I think Daniel's drive was exemplary," Jones said in an interview with Reuters.
